I-LUNASYS: Innovative Lunar Water Resource System
AQUALUNAR CHALLENGE FINALIST
Developed by Perspective Space-Tech Ltd, London.
Using motorised pumps controlled by sensors, samples are heated at a constant pressure to separate and remove impurities as gas (isobaric vaporisation, followed by isothermal distillation). Using membranes and carbon filters, reverse osmosis separates the water molecules from the sample before entering a final UV filtration system. The system would be designed to be maintained by robots and could have new processes easily plugged into the system using “fluidic circuitry boards”.
